When inhaled, the scent molecules in essential oils travel from the olfactory nerves directly to … WebOlfactory training consisted of sniffing twice daily felt-tip pens with the four standard odorants: phenylethanol, 1,8-cineole, citronellal, eugenol. In the low intensity training, 0.0001% concentrations were used. This was determined to be the lowest detectable threshold concentration for a healthy population. WebAug 23, 2024 · Anatomy. A 2015 study found that borneol reduced pain sensitivity ... WebFollowing is step by step process: Step 1: Sprinkle 2-3 drops of the oil onto a cotton pad and let the aroma develop for a minute. Step 2: Bring the pad to your nose and inhale the scent for 20 seconds with a series of short “bunny sniffs”. As you do this, visualize and conjure up memories of the aroma.
